Output caf38383130e3830c9ebbfdc89a832b71e538c8cbd29a48840eb5d883ca4a15c:23

value
1075424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15e0d3f71335d389ec7d2f0adf9d9722c49611b7 OP_EQUAL
address
33ghStr5S6Sy7kfEnKdY7NhuTr7YYRxett
transaction
caf38383130e3830c9ebbfdc89a832b71e538c8cbd29a48840eb5d883ca4a15c
spent
true